Course Details
• Ethical Foundations in Healthcare Communication: Understanding the ethical principles that guide healthcare communication, including respect for autonomy, non-maleficence, beneficence, and justice.
• Cultural Competence in Global Healthcare Communication: Developing awareness and skills to communicate effectively with diverse populations, taking into account cultural differences in health beliefs, values, and practices.
• Patient-Centered Communication: Learning evidence-based communication strategies that promote patient-centered care, shared decision-making, and patient engagement.
• Digital Health Communication: Examining the opportunities and challenges of digital technologies in healthcare communication, including telemedicine, social media, and patient portals.
• Crisis Communication in Healthcare: Preparing for and managing communication during healthcare crises, such as pandemics, natural disasters, and medical errors.
• Health Literacy and Communication: Addressing health literacy barriers and promoting clear and effective health communication for all populations.
• Interprofessional Communication in Healthcare: Fostering effective communication and collaboration among healthcare professionals to improve patient outcomes.
• Ethical Considerations in Global Healthcare Communication: Exploring ethical issues in global healthcare communication, such as informed consent, confidentiality, and cultural sensitivity.
• Research and Evaluation in Healthcare Communication: Developing skills to conduct research and evaluate healthcare communication interventions to improve patient care and outcomes.
